Welcome to the Quillcast validator platform. Plugin authors extend our podcast feed validation pipeline by registering rule modules against the manifest schema. Each rule receives a parsed feed tree and returns structured findings; never mutate the tree in place, as downstream rules share it. Sandbox runs are rate-limited but free. Before your first submission, you must unlock the plugin signing keystore on the Larkfield sandbox, which requires the recovery passphrase shown below.

strongbox words: wenix-ulador

## Releases

ChirpGate produces high log volume, so each release includes a sampling config that caps emission at the edge before anything reaches retention. For security review: sampled-out events are counted, never silently dropped, and audit-class logs bypass sampling entirely. Release artifacts are built reproducibly and published to the Fenwick registry. Verification matters here because sampling configs are executable policy; confirm each artifact against the signing key below.

release key, hadug-kawef: bky13_mPGeFZeR1GZ1G

**Mgmt Meeting Minutes — Retiring the Brightline Range**

Quick recap for sales leads at Fenholt Supplies: we agreed to retire the Brightline fixture range by year-end. Remaining stock moves to clearance pricing next month, and accounts on standing orders get migrated to the Lumetta range. Trade-in incentives were approved in principle. The confidential note on next steps sits just below.

board note of bajof-bajeg: The pricing group signed off on a budget of $13.4 million for Project Sildor. The renewal with Lamixek Holdings closes at $48.9 million a year, 49 percent above the last contract.

## Support

Running into weirdness with the Hopdash driver-assignment heuristic? First check the scoring weights in `assign_config.yaml` — nine times out of ten someone tweaked the distance penalty. The simulator in `tools/replay` lets you re-run yesterday's assignments locally before blaming the algorithm. Known quirks are tracked on the team wiki under "Hopdash gotchas." Still stuck after all that? Drop the routing crew a line.

escalation mailbox, yajeg-bageg: quenax.olidor@lumiccorp.internal